The twists:

JoelDavies selects the boxes!

My usual method of producing these weekly games is to play a game online on Saturday, save some screenshots, upload them to imgur, and post them here at the right times. But not this week! This week, JoelDavies won the right to select the boxes! Now the progression of amounts taken out will be decided by a player instead of me!

But wait! There's more! JoelDavies will select the box to bring to the table! So, JoelDavies, think long and hard about this choice; you will be very directly influencing this game with this!

10% Bonus!

Each amount on the board has been upped by 10%! Here is what the board looks like now!

Image

The 1p is unaffected as I refuse to hand out fractional pennies. ;)

Note that the top prize has been boosted to £275,000!!! Given that these kinds of weeks don't typically happen, you might want to make the most of this opportunity to win more than £250,000! :D

1p Special Offer!

Whenever JoelDavies successfully takes out the box containing the 1p, the banker will immediately make a non-negotiable offer of 110% the DealEye Benchmark. If the 1p is found in the final box of the round, this will of course preempt the usual offer (so no negotiations will be taken). If the 1p is left until the end... tough luck! :P

One box at a time at 5-box!

What game would be special without the opportunity of proceeding one box at a time? :)

Due to the extra offers, the rounds will be posted at strange times. This is why I will be banker this week; I can make the offer immediately when the round is posted instead of worrying about when the guest banker would be available to post offers. Tentatively, the rounds will be posted at the following times (UK time, of course):

Round 1 (17-box): Saturday, August 24, 11:59 p.m.
Round 2 (14-box): Sunday, August 25, 6:00 p.m.
Round 3 (11-box): Monday, August 26, 12:00 p.m.
Round 4 (8-box): Tuesday, August 27, 1:00 a.m.
Round 5 (5-box): Tuesday, August 27, 11:59 p.m.
Round 5.33 (4-box): Wednesday, August 28, 6:00 p.m.
Round 5.67 (3-box): Thursday, August 29, 12:00 p.m.
Round 6 (2-box): Friday, August 29, 12:00 p.m.
Final reveal: Saturday, August 30, 12:00 p.m.

This will probably change depending on external factors (i.e., if I somehow forget to follow this schedule) or if the 1p is found in the middle of a round. I tried to fit 18 hours to a round, but I need to make sure I'm awake and not busy at the time of the posting!

Negotiations!

...remain the same. I just wanted to be clear that they're not forgotten. As always, you have one chance at a negotiation, and if they're accepted, that's your new personal offer, but if they're rejected, you will face a 10% penalty. Remember that I will not be accepting negotiations for the 1p bonus offer.
